This has not been an easy year for the hospitality industry. Staffing is one of the biggest challenges. So all ratings for 2020-2021 may not be so useful in future years. But let it be noted that after a quarter-century in China, the room service boiled dumplings were among the worst I've ever had. And tonight, despite the room service menu having only a very few items on it, the kitchen could not produce a simple sandwich. The bottled beer was room temperature, and the staff did not open it (no opener in the room, btw.) Didn't come with a glass, either.||||That said, the executive floor rooms are large and clean, same with bathrooms. Three soft drinks in the fridge and a "fangbianmian" (look it up) the only food amenity. Buffet breakfast in the lobby's "Western restaurant" is strictly Chinese save the coffee and juice (plus, no cutlery, salt or pepper on the table).||||But count your blessings: room is quiet and comfortable; wifi is fine; staff is competent (except for those guys on the room service phone)! Read moreSo I am about to check out of my hotel stay at the Jinjiang Int’l hotel and I have to say I am impressed. From check-in to check-out, I did not run into very many problems during my stay. As a foreigner some places can make you feel uncomfortable but here, I did not feel out of place. The staff kindly spoke in English where my Chinese has failed me. Even though breakfast was closed at 10am, they let me come in with only 15 minutes left and kindly waited until I finished. Solid selection of food. At this price points I would recommend any foreigners to stay in this hotel because they definitely are of service. Good location for taxis and not too far from the bar district.
